Reconstruction:Proto-Brythonic/gnọd
Proto-Brythonic
Etymology
From Proto-Celtic *gnātos, from Proto-Indo-European *ǵn̥h₃tós.
Adjective
*gnọd
Descendants
- Old Breton: gnot
- Middle Welsh: gnawt
- Welsh: gnawd
